Abstract

What is the Word of God ? It is God Himself in His being for us, «in search of our Salvation», as distinct from the means of communicating this care, such as Scripture . The word of God is defined as «Scripture united with Tradition» , pointing out that it is with the latter, in its relation to the Church and its Magisterium, that is found the greatest theological gap. The Word of God can refer to the «sacramental presence" of Christ: in its «exterior sign» , which is the Scripture as book and text; in its «interior sign» , which is Scripture as an «inspired» Book interpreted in the Church; and in its «ultimate reality» , which is the «truth for our salvation» , the final end of the Word of God
